============================== b01.txt ============================== t07.03.00 build 1 - 2 July 07 == D0Reco: qzli btags_cert v00-03-41 <- v00-03-40 Update jlip p20 resolution functions. d0root_jlip v00-01-04 <- v00-01-03 Update jlip p20 resolution functions. vertexutil v00-09-35 <- v00-09-34 Fixed the indices problem of tracks associated to the Vertex by changing _ntrkmask nbits=8 to 16 in VtxTmbObj.hpp. == D0Correct/CSG: greenlee tmb_tree_maker v01-00-64 <- v01-00-63 Add min bias probability to primary vertex branch. == Monte Carlo: tadams d0raw2sim v01-01-05 <- v01-01-01 Synchronize with the p20-branch: create the LumiInfoChunk when running D0Raw2Sim (RCP + bin/OBJECT changes) pileup v00-17-00 <- v00-16-02 Synchronize with the p20-branch: transmit the LumiInfoChunk from the output of D0Raw2Sim to the output of D0Sim == Examines: Oshima muo_examine v07-01-06 <- v07-01-05 Updated the defaults for the new scintillator trigger timing histos (by Yuriy Yatsunenko) ============================== b02.txt ============================== t07.03.00 build 2 - 11 July 07 == D0Correct/CSG: greenlee caf_eff_utils v01-09-10 <- v01-09-09 Remove obsolete xml code from test file caf_mc_util v01-05-06 <- v01-05-02 caf_util v03-13-02 <- v03-12-02 Remove doJESMU switch from ApplyJES. This will force JESMU recalculation in all cases. Change GetChargedTrack to getPtrChpSpatial track match in ElectronSelector. Update beam spot file. Updates for TreeHandler. Update METsigAlg. Adopt isMC methode from cafe::Event Tau modifications. eff_utils v02-00-01 <- v01-13-00 Add possibility to read/write n dimensional histogram from/to sp file with any value of n. Transform BinnedEfficiency to the histogram class. Add number of events to the EffVal object and spc format. jet_evt v00-00-43 <- v00-00-42 Modify the access to the trigger tower energies when calculating the variables used for the L1 confirmation of jets. It now uses a new (and faster) method which automatically takes into account the cabling problems in stores 5435-5533 tmb_tree v01-02-16 <- v01-02-13 Fix bug in accessor for the L1CTT subsector occupancy (was not accessing correctly each 4th subsector) Add a new variable for the L1 calorimeter EM objects containing the isolation flag tmb_tree_trigger_maker v01-00-37 <- v01-00-34 Fix bug in the filling of the CTT subsector occupancies (each 4th subsector was not being filled up). Fill the AndOr names for the CTT occupancy vetoes. In the code which fills the information for the L1 calorimeter trigger replace the l1cal2b_sliding_windows package with the l1cal2b_alg package == D0Reco: qzli d0root_reco v00-01-31 <- v00-01-30 Add rcp for p20 vertex fixing. fixp13tmb_calprob v00-01-01 <- v00-01-00 Update p20 fixing rcps to turn off track refit. l1cal2b_alg v00-00-07 <- new New package used for the emulation of the L1 calorimeter trigger of Run2B (replaces the old l1cal2b_sliding_windows package) == Level 2: cwiok l1l2_evt v02-04-01 <- v02-03-05 Add a new method which allows fast access to the L1 calorimeter trigger towers and takes into account a cabling issue for stores 5435-5533 (this method is used in the jet reconstruction while calculating the variables for the L1 confirmation of jets) l1l2_reco v02-03-07 <- v02-03-05 Keep track of the routing master copy of the L2 bits (to be used to diagnosed problems with the trigger framework). l2gblworker v01-02-04 <- v01-02-03 Fixed script overflow problem. fillScriptData returns TRUE when a script has overflowed, not false! Added fix to set the number of scripts stored in the L2 global header data block correctly. == Level 3: dbauer l3ftrack_cft v01-14-00 <- v01-11-00 Port changes from p19 branch to the test release. This is the version currently running online. == Infrastructure: jonckheere file_util v00-00-01 <- new New package containing a utility function to figure out whether to read initialization data from $SRT_PRIVATE_CONTEXT/rundata/package/file or $SRT_PUBLIC_CONTEXT/rundata/package/file Calling sequence is #include "file_util/FileUtil.hpp" std::string fullPath = getFullFilePath(package,file); (this avoids duplicating the same code in each package where this is necessary). ============================== b03.txt ============================== t07.03.00 build 3 - 26 July 07 == Monte Carlo: tadams mcatnlo v03-03-01 <- v03-02-01 Upgrade to MC@NLO 3.3 mcpp_gen v00-16-23 <- v00-16-22 includes changes for MC@NLO and Sherpa == D0Reco: qzli chpart_reco v00-07-15 <- v00-07-14 Update rcp for converting charged particles to GTracks. gtr_find v00-23-27 <- v00-23-26 Add GtrMissPkg. == Level 1: mverzocc l1cal2b_alg v00-00-08 <- v00-00-07 Fix bug in the code which emulates the tau trigger (swapped < and >) == Level 3: dbauer l3fcftunpack v00-04-20 <- v00-04-19 Ensure consistent return value when encountering oscure read out failure. == External: jonckheere lhapdf v5_1 -q gcc344:+x86_64 <- v5_2_2 -q lts3_32 (or x86_64) Use same version as in p20 and p21 ============================== b04.txt ============================== t07.03.00 build 4 - 30 Aug 07 == Data Quality: jonckheere caf_dq v02-02-02 <- new dq_util v02-03-00 <- new Add DQ packages to release == CAF/CSG: greenlee caf_mc_util v01-05-09 <- v01-05-06 Add processor ApplyElectronSmear. Update file lists. caf_util v03-16-00 <- v03-13-02 Add CleanICRJets processor. Add tau NN for run 2b (TauSelector). Add tau correction in ReComputMet. cafe v01-00-93 <- v01-00-90 Add RandomProcessor and RandomSelectUserObjects. Update Trigger to handle TMBTrigBits. Add integrated test for Trigger. eff_utils v02-01-00 <- v02-00-01 Add method BinnedEfficiency::projection. emid_cuts v03-00-02 <- v03-00-01 Update em cuts. Add additional cut definitions. tau_cand v03-01-00 <- v03-00-01 add NN kernels for p20 tau_tmb v00-03-00 <- v00-02-00 update TauNNoutput for p20 kernels tmb_tree v01-02-18 <- v01-02-16 Add TMBHiPtWeight branch. Add setter in TMBEMCluster. == D0Reco: qzli cft_evt v00-29-00 <- v00-28-11 cft_reco v00-33-00 <- v00-32-06 cft_reco2D v00-02-00 <- v00-01-05 cft_trf v00-28-00 <- v00-27-28 cft_trfclus v00-01-00 <- v00-00-64 Made changes necessary for incorporation of timing information from AFEII-t. In synch with p20-br at this time. cft_unpdata v00-41-11-temp <- v00-47-11-br-01 Made changes necessary for incorporation of timing information from AFEII-t. In synch with p20-br at this time. This is a placeholder for the real high level unpacker that won't break anything. d0root_jlip v00-01-05 <- v00-01-04 Update run 2b resolution functions. Add missing version in Categories.cat muo_evt v00-02-10 <- v00-02-09 Fix bug in MuonQualityInfo::MuonQualityInfo(const MuTmbObj*) constructor. The _etrack_best member is now initialized. sftclus v00-29-00 <- v00-28-04 sftdigi v00-53-00 <- v00-52-01 sftdigi_evt v00-27-00 <- v00-26-06 sftdigi_reco v00-32-00 <- v00-30-00 Made changes necessary for incorporation of timing information from AFEII-t. In synch with p20-br at this time. == Graphics: oshima d0ve_caldis v04-02-05 <- v04-02-03 d0ve_reco v04-02-05 <- v04-02-03 Introduced trackjet eta. d0ve_vertex v04-05-00 <- v04-04-04 Making better display, printing and matching of MC vertex info. Added summupt variable and did apply primary vertex cut to pvz/pvn by _maxpvz/_maxpvn respectively. ============================== b05.txt ============================== t07.03.00 build 5 - 10 Sept 07 == D0Reco: qzli cal_calibration v00-03-00 <- v01-02-00 cal_nlc v01-03-01 <- v01-02-00 caltables v00-06-01 <- v00-05-01 calunpdata v01-01-01 <- v01-00-04 -Bugs corrected: memory leakage -ICD included in the fixing. In package fixp13tmb_calprob the file reco_cal_p20fixing.rcp must be modified to fix the energy of cells. -ICD included in MC (new file with typical ICD constants) All these versions can be used for p20, p21 and p20.L3 releases cft_evt v00-29-01 <- v00-29-00 Added auto-detection for version of CftClusterChunk so that the "activate" method correctly unpacks old clusters with no timing information as well as new clusters. em_util v00-03-04 <- v00-03-03 - Calculation of r-DCA w.r.t the (0,0,0) instead of PV for CFT-only tracks; - Correction(inversion) of the r-DCA sign in the track extrapolation/matching code - Correction for the track pT for tracks w/o SMT hits emreco v00-18-05 <- v00-18-02 - Correction for the track pT for tracks w/o SMT hits - EM energy smearing corrections: - Correction of the bug for CC non-fiducial EM clusters - New energy smearing parameters. == CAF/CSG: greenlee gtr_find v00-23-28 <- v00-23-27 == Graphics: alverson d0scan_qt v00-03-03 <- v00-03-01 Bug fixes, including multi-thread dying in rcp acces == External: alverson/jonckheere (all for Graphics) qt v3_3_8 -q gcc344_dzero:x86_64 <- qt v3_3_2 -q gcc344:x86_64 iguana v6_14_0f1 -q gcc344_dzero:x86_64 <- v4.2.4 -q gcc344:x86_64 coin v2_4_5_f1 -q gcc344_dzero:x86_64 <- v2.3.0 -q gcc344:x86_64 freetype v2.3.5 -q gcc344_dzero:x86_64 <- "new" mesa v7_0_1 -q gcc344_dzero:x86_64 <- v6_1 -q gcc344:x86_64 **** 64 bit libs **** == Trigsim: dbauer d0trigsim v01-03-19 <- v01-03-18 Changed rcp files so that only the appropriate unpacker is run for L1/l2 and L3. tsim_l3 v00-03-19 <- v00-03-17 Updates for new cal calibration file (from p19). Removed obsolete reference to l3fanalyze. == Level 3: dbauer l3fanalyze delete <- v00-04-11 l3ffpd_si delete <- v00-01-02 l3ftrack_mc delete <- v00-06-27 l3fvertex delete <- v00-03-07 Package is obsolete, please remove from release. l3filters v00-07-11 <- v00-07-08 -Bug fix for the L3FAngleMhtJet filter: handle properly the case in which two jets have the same phi but different rapidities -Removed obsolete filters and bug fix for the L3FAngleMhtJet filter -handle properly the case in which two jets have the same phi but different rapidities (from Marco). l3ftrack_smt v00-07-05 <- v00-07-04 Removed some obsolete analysis code. l3tCalUnpTool v00-09-01 <- v00-09-00 Include updated cal calibration file. trigdb_scripts v00-02-30 <- v00-02-29 Removed obsolete filters. ============================== b06.txt ============================== t07.03.00 build 6 - 11 Sept 07 == D0Reco: qzli cal_calibration v01-03-00 <- v00-03-00 use the correct version number cft_calibdata v00-00-13 <- v00-00-12 cft_unpdata v00-48-00 <- v00-41-11-temp unpack_ft_fe v00-04-00 <- v00-03-01 unpack_svx_fe v00-05-16 <- v00-05-15 unpack_vrb v00-01-08 <- v00-01-07 Made changes necessary to unpack new data format for CFT that now includes timing information from the AFEII-t boards. == Level 3: dbauer ScriptRunner v00-10-44 <- v00-10-43 Removed reference to obsolete primary vertex tool. l3fJetMEt v00-02-07 <- v00-02-06 Removed some obsolete analysis code (the binary had been removed for a while anyway) that depended on other now officially obsolete packages. == External: jonckheere iguana 6_14_0f1 -q gcc3_4_3_dzero:rh7_1 <- v6.12.2f1 -q gcc3_4_3_dzero:rh7_1 Graphics update. ============================== b07.txt ============================== t07.03.00 build 7 - 12 Sept 07 == D0Reco: qzli em_util_scale v00-01-02 <- v00-01-01 needed for emreco package cft_evt v00-29-00 <- v00-29-01 cft_calibdata v00-00-12 <- v00-00-13 cft_unpdata v00-41-11-temp <- v00-48-00 unpack_ft_fe v00-03-01 <- v00-04-00 unpack_svx_fe v00-05-15 <- v00-05-16 unpack_vrb v00-01-07 <- v00-01-08 BACKOUT CHANGES == Data Quality: jonckheere dq_util v02-04-00 <- v02-03-00 - Completely removed the "newconst" switches. - All lumitool files will not have the '_newconst'. - It was not done consistently. - Assumes, however, that the .caf files from getLuminosity have a '_newconstant' in the name. - more Epochs in the example file (from vertex Z reweighting) - can now read CAF files with -ignoreduplicate warning (above from Michael Weber) - Create minimal tests ============================== b08.txt ============================== t07.03.00 build 8 - 13 Sept 07 == D0Reco: qzli cft_calibdata v00-00-13 <- v00-00-12 cft_unpdata v00-48-00 <- v00-41-11-temp unpack_vrb v00-01-08 <- v00-01-07 cft_evt v00-29-01 <- v00-29-00 restore previous changes with other packages fixed. sftdigi_evt v00-27-00 <- v00-27-00 added new uncalibrated SFTDigiChunk for examine. unpack_ft_fe v00-04-01 <- v00-03-01 Moved new unpacking code here to remove circular dependences in base unpacker unpack_svx_fe v00-05-17 <- v00-05-15 Moved new unpacking code to unpack_ft_fe to remove circular dependences in base unpacker; revert to v00-05-15 == Level 3: dbauer ScriptRunner v00-10-45 <- v00-10-44 Removed hopefully the last dependencies on obsolete packages. gtr_l3 v00-03-01 <- v00-02-02 Updates for usage with latest L3 global tracker (L3TCFTTrack), which is running online. Remove inclusion of MC packages in executable (because of the disappearance of l3ftrack_mc) l3fTestClasses v00-03-04 <- v00-03-03 Removed dependencies from obsolete packages. l3femtools v00-05-03 <- v00-05-02 Adapt to interface change in em_util_scale. l3filters v00-07-12 <- v00-07-11 Hopefully removed the last dependencies on obsolete packages. trigsim_analyze v00-02-09 <- v00-02-08 Removed L3 bit. Has been superceded by trigsimcert since p17. tsim_l3 v00-03-20 <- v00-03-19 Removed obsolete dependencies from stand alone executable. == CAF/CSG: greenlee d0ommodule v00-01-24 <- v00-01-23 Add method read_user_header to python extension type d0Stream. ============================== b09.txt ============================== sftdigi_evt v00-27-01 <- v00-27-00 fix typo in version number ============================== b10.txt ============================== t07.03.00 build 10 - 17 Sept 07 == Level 3: dbauer l3fcalib_cft v00-02-03 <- v00-02-02 Unconst calib class, so it can be updated from two different sources Adapt to change in underlying software. == D0Reco: qzli sftdigi_evt v00-27-02 <- v00-27-01 Fixed COMPONENTS and D0OM_COMPONENTS to include new SFTDigiUnCalChunk. Also fixed minor component test problem. ============================== b11.txt ============================== t07.03.00 build 11 - 18 Sept 07 == D0Reco: qzli unpack_ft_fe v00-04-02 <- v00-04-01 Fixed typo in SVXMCHCFTChannel that caused circular return infinite loop. Commented out lines in FTMCHModule.cpp to treat special run but are not relevant for all other data. == Level 3: dbauer trigdb_scripts v00-02-31 <- v00-02-30 Updated tool parameter range for secondary vertex tool. == External: jonckheere coin v2_4_5_f1 gcc3_4_3_dzero:rh7_1 <- v2.4.3 -q gcc3_4_3_dzero:rh7_1 Fixes build problems